Sofirn HS40 Rechargeable Headlamp

Model: A-001

Introduction

The Sofirn HS40 is a versatile and powerful headlamp designed for various outdoor activities and daily tasks. Featuring a high-performance SST40 LED, it delivers up to 2000 lumens of bright light, ensuring excellent visibility. Its robust construction, IPX8 water resistance, and convenient USB-C charging make it a reliable companion in diverse environments. The magnetic tail cap and two-way clip enhance its utility, allowing it to function as both a headlamp and a handheld or clipped flashlight.

Setup

  1. Battery Installation: Unscrew the tail cap of the headlamp. Remove the orange insulating disc from the positive end of the battery. Insert the 18650 battery with the positive (+) end facing towards the head of the lamp. Screw the tail cap back on tightly to ensure proper contact and water resistance.
  2. Attaching Head Band: Slide the headlamp body into the silicone mount on the adjustable head band. Ensure the headlamp is securely seated.
  3. Initial Charging: Before first use, fully charge the headlamp. Connect the provided USB-C cable to the charging port on the headlamp and plug the other end into a 5V/2A USB power adapter (not included). The indicator light will show red during charging and turn green when fully charged.

Operating Instructions

The Sofirn HS40 features both Stepped Mode and Stepless Ramping for brightness control.

Basic Operation

  • Turn On/Off: Single click the side switch to turn the light on or off.
  • Change Brightness (Stepped Mode): When the light is on, press and hold the side switch to cycle through Moon, Low, Medium, High. Release the switch to select the desired brightness level.
  • Turbo Mode: From ON, double-click the side switch to activate Turbo. Double-click again to return to the previous mode.
  • Moonlight Mode: From OFF, press and hold the side switch for 1 second to activate Moonlight mode.
  • Lock/Unlock: From OFF, 4 clicks to lock the headlamp. The main LED will flash twice to indicate it is locked. 4 clicks again to unlock. The main LED will flash once to indicate it is unlocked.

Advanced Operation (Stepless Ramping)

  • Activate Ramping: From ON, triple-click the side switch to switch between Stepped Mode and Stepless Ramping.
  • Adjust Brightness (Ramping): In Stepless Ramping mode, press and hold the side switch to smoothly increase or decrease the brightness. Release the switch to set the desired level.

Special Modes (Strobe, SOS, Beacon)

  • From ON, triple-click the side switch to enter Strobe mode.
  • While in Strobe mode, double-click to cycle through Strobe, SOS, and Beacon modes.
  • Single click to turn off the light.

Maintenance

  • Charging: Recharge the battery when the indicator light flashes red, indicating low battery. Use the provided USB-C cable and a compatible 5V/2A adapter.
  • Cleaning: Clean the headlamp with a soft, damp cloth. Do not use abrasive cleaners or solvents.
  • O-ring Maintenance: Periodically lubricate the O-rings with silicone grease to maintain water resistance. Replace O-rings if they appear damaged or worn.
  • Water Resistance: The HS40 is IPX8 rated, meaning it is protected against continuous immersion in water up to 2 meters. Ensure the USB-C port cover is securely closed before exposing to water.

Troubleshooting

  • Light does not turn on:
    • Ensure the battery is inserted correctly with the positive (+) end towards the head.
    • Check if the orange insulating disc has been removed from the battery.
    • Confirm the tail cap is screwed on tightly.
    • The headlamp might be in Lockout Mode. Perform 4 clicks to unlock it.
    • Battery may be depleted. Charge the headlamp fully.
  • Light is dim or flickers:
    • Battery charge is low. Recharge the headlamp.
    • Ensure battery contacts are clean. Clean with a cotton swab if necessary.
  • Charging not working:
    • Verify the USB-C cable is properly connected to both the headlamp and the power source.
    • Try a different USB-C cable or power adapter.
    • Ensure the charging port is free of debris.

Specifications

Feature Specification
Brand Sofirn
Model HS40 (A-001)
Light Source SST40 LED
Color Temperature 6500 Kelvin
Max Brightness 2000 Lumens
Max Beam Distance 175 Meters
Power Source Battery Powered (1x 18650 Lithium Ion)
Battery Capacity 3000mAh (included)
Charging Port USB Type-C (5V/2A input)
Water Resistance IPX8 (up to 2 meters underwater, not for diving)
Material Aluminum
Item Weight 65 Grams (headlamp only) / 2.29 ounces
Product Dimensions 4.72"D x 0.98"W x 0.98"H
Runtime (High) 2 hours
Runtime (Medium) 8 hours
Runtime (Moonlight) 400 hours
